São Paulo, Brazil’s vibrant financial center, is among the world's most populous cities, with numerous cultural institutions and a rich architectural tradition. Its iconic buildings range from its neo-Gothic cathedral and the 1929 Martinelli skyscraper to modernist architect Oscar Niemeyer’s curvy Edifício Copan. The colonial-style Pátio do Colégio church marks where Jesuit priests founded the city in 1554.
Currency | Real, R$1 = 100 centavos |
---|---|
Population | Approximately 11.8 million |
Newspaper | Journal do Brasil, Folha de São Paulo, Estado de São Paulo, O Globo |
Opening Hours | Shops are normally open Mon-Sat 9am-6pm, closed over lunch. Banks are open from Mon-Fri 10am-4pm. |
Emergency Number | Police: 190,Emergency: 192,Fire Brigade: 193,Tourist Police (Rua São Bento 380): +55 11 3107 5642 |
Electricity | 110 V, 60 Hz. Some hotels have both 110 and 220 V outlets. |
